Output d566ea186724acbdbeb051015e332641566f70a17ba1c265c30e641712daa506:1

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c5f441f351f9c65438b8ab86242f737c7776ac5 OP_EQUALVERIFY OP_CHECKSIG
address
17xpUnTvTZZpxgmbHSs5ctEeafuqfiM2vX
transaction
d566ea186724acbdbeb051015e332641566f70a17ba1c265c30e641712daa506
spent
true